Запитання з тегом «database»

База даних - це організований збір даних. Це колекція схем, таблиць, запитів, звітів, поглядів та інших об'єктів. Дані, як правило, організовуються для моделювання аспектів реальності таким чином, щоб підтримувати процеси, що вимагають інформації. Використовуйте цей тег, якщо у вас є питання щодо проектування бази даних. Якщо мова йде про конкретну систему управління базами даних (наприклад, MySQL), будь ласка, використовуйте замість цього тег.


30
Хороша бібліотека PHP ORM?
Відповіді на це запитання - це зусилля громади . Відредагуйте наявні відповіді, щоб покращити цю публікацію. Наразі він не приймає нових відповідей чи взаємодій. Чи є хороша об'єктно-реляційна бібліотека для відображення PHP? Я знаю PDO / ADO, але вони, здається, забезпечують лише абстрагування відмінностей між постачальниками баз даних, а не …
268 php  database  orm 

4
Рамка сутності та об'єднання підключень
Нещодавно я почав використовувати Entity Framework 4.0 в моєму додатку .NET 4.0 і мені цікаво кілька речей, що стосуються об'єднання. Пул з'єднання, як я знаю, керує постачальником даних ADO.NET, в моєму випадку - сервером MS SQL. Чи застосовується це, коли ви інстанціюєте новий контекст сутності ( ObjectContext), тобто параметр new …


12
Чи є обгортка .NET / C # для SQLite? [зачинено]
Зачинено. Це питання не відповідає вказівкам щодо переповнення стека . Наразі відповіді не приймаються. Хочете вдосконалити це питання? Оновіть питання, щоб воно було тематичним для переповнення стека. Закрито 2 роки тому . Удосконаліть це питання Я хотів би використовувати SQLite з C # .Net, але я не можу знайти відповідну …
267 c#  .net  database  sqlite 

3
Модель Django () проти Model.objects.create ()
Яка різниця між виконанням двох команд: foo = FooModel() і bar = BarModel.objects.create() Чи створює другий одразу ж BarModelбазу даних у базі даних, тоді як для FooModel, save()метод повинен бути явно викликаний, щоб додати його до бази даних?

15
Помилка MySQL: 'Доступ заборонено користувачеві' root '@' localhost '
$ ./mysqladmin -u root -p ' відредаговано ' Введіть пароль: mysqladmin: помилка підключення до сервера на "localhost": "Доступ заборонено для користувача" root "@" localhost "(з використанням пароля: ТАК)" Як я можу це виправити?

9
Найкращий спосіб зробити багаторядкові вставки в Oracle?
Я шукаю хороший спосіб виконати багаторядкові вставки в базу даних Oracle 9. Наступні роботи в MySQL, але, схоже, не підтримуються в Oracle. INSERT INTO TMP_DIM_EXCH_RT (EXCH_WH_KEY, EXCH_NAT_KEY, EXCH_DATE, EXCH_RATE, FROM_CURCY_CD, TO_CURCY_CD, EXCH_EFF_DATE, EXCH_EFF_END_DATE, EXCH_LAST_UPDATED_DATE) VALUES (1, 1, '28-AUG-2008', 109.49, 'USD', 'JPY', '28-AUG-2008', '28-AUG-2008', '28-AUG-2008'), (2, 1, '28-AUG-2008', .54, 'USD', 'GBP', …

7
Замок Liquibase - причини?
Я отримую це під час запуску безлічі скриптів likibase на сервері Oracle. Якийськомп'ютер - це я. Waiting for changelog lock.... Waiting for changelog lock.... Waiting for changelog lock.... Waiting for changelog lock.... Waiting for changelog lock.... Waiting for changelog lock.... Waiting for changelog lock.... Liquibase Update Failed: Could not acquire …


30
Що не так із іноземними ключами?
Я пам’ятаю, як чув у Джоуста Спольського, який у подкасті 014 згадував, що він ледь не використовував іноземний ключ (якщо я правильно пам'ятаю). Однак мені здаються досить важливими, щоб уникнути дублювання та подальших проблем із цілісністю даних у вашій базі даних. У людей є якісь вагомі причини того, щоб (щоб …

21
Яка найкраща практика для первинних ключів у таблицях?
Створюючи таблиці, я виробив звичку мати один стовпчик, який є унікальним, і я роблю первинний ключ. Це досягається трьома способами залежно від вимог: Ідентифікаційний цілий стовпець, який автоматично збільшується. Унікальний ідентифікатор (GUID) Колонка з коротким символом (x) або цілим числом (або іншим відносно невеликим числовим типом), що може слугувати стовпцем …

15
Чому SELECT * вважається шкідливим?
Чому це SELECT *погана практика? Чи не означало б це зменшення коду, якби ви додали потрібний новий стовпець? Я розумію, що SELECT COUNT(*)це проблема продуктивності деяких БД, але що робити, якщо ви дійсно хотіли кожного стовпця?
256 sql  database 


14
Як кешувати дані в додатку MVC
Я прочитав багато інформації про кешування сторінок та часткове кешування сторінок у додатку MVC. Однак я хотів би знати, як ви кешуватимете дані. У моєму сценарії я буду використовувати LINQ для сутностей (структура сутності). Під час першого дзвінка до GetNames (або будь-якого способу) я хочу захопити дані з бази даних. …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.